With and without the battery connected, I get the 20v on charger and a charging battery symbol on the screen, but does nothing else.

Plugged in charger, I get 20v 0.75-1.2 amps for 25-30 seconds
  • This is with the board alone on the desk
  • After 25-30 seconds, it will go to 20v 0 amps until I have to replug the charger or trigger SMC_ONOFF__L

PPBUS_G3H = 12.6v
PM_PWRBTN_L = 3.3v
PM_PWRBTN_L = 0v when SMC_ONOFF_L is triggered
PM_SLP_S4_L pulses when SMC_ONOFF_L is triggered
  • stays on for 25-30 seconds along with CPU_VCORE
  • CPU_VCORE = 0.733 volts goes to 0.600 volts after 15 seconds or so then to 0 volts after 25-30 seconds
  • If connected to a display, it will show a charging battery symbol on the screen

Do you get charging, or low battery level logo?
I suppose SMC believes the battery is low and shutsdown.

Check what happens booting in SMC bypass mode.
Be sure to use original 87W charger.
